What do you need to rent a car in Upper Town?
Before you can hit the road in Upper Town, you'll need a driver's license and a credit card in the same name. If you don't take out the rental company's insurance policy, you may also have to show proof of other coverage. Rules can vary, so understand the policy terms and conditions before you choose a rental company.

Can I drive in Upper Town with my current driver's license?
If you don't hold a driver's license issued in Canada, then you might need to get an International Driving Permit (IDP) in your home country to be allowed to rent a car. It's also important to note that if you do need an IDP, it has no validity on its own. You'll have to show your current driver's license your passport and other forms of documentation as well. Lastly, it's important that the credit card used to book the rental matches the name on your license and passport. Some other things to note for international car rentals are:

  • Age restrictions: You need to be 25 or older in most countries to rent a car. If you're younger than that, it may still be possible to rent a car but you'll have to pay a Young Driver's Surcharge. Additional restrictions may also apply to the types of vehicles available to rent.
  • Driving limitations: Be sure to read the fine print before driving away. You typically can't cross country borders, drive on ferries or on certain types of rugged terrain with a rental car.
